Effektives Node.js Monitoring: Metriken, Warnmeldungen und Best Practices
Dieser Leitfaden befasst sich eingehend mit dem effektiven Monitoring von Node.js-Anwendungen. Er behandelt das Monitoring von Laufzeitmetriken (Speicher, CPU), Anwendungsmetriken (Anforderungsraten, Antwortzeiten) und Geschäftsmetriken (Benutzeraktionen, Conversion-Raten). Die Bedeutung des Monitorings wird betont, wobei detailliert beschrieben wird, wie diese Metriken erfasst und aussagekräftige Warnmeldungen eingerichtet werden. Häufige Fehler beim Monitoring, wie das Missverstehen von Sägezahnmustern im Speicher und das Ignorieren von Perzentilen, werden angesprochen. Der Leitfaden zeigt auch, wie Metriken mit dem Geschäftswert verknüpft und über die Produktion hinaus verwendet werden können, z. B. bei Benchmark-Tests, Lasttests und A/B-Tests.